PARIS (AP) — France recorded at least 5,700 more deaths than usual during a historic heatwave last month, the public health agency said Wednesday, sharply increasing its estimates of the feared toll from record-shattering temperatures.

Public Health France said regions hit by the heat from June 17 to July 2 recorded 21,674 deaths from all causes. But without a heatwave, those same regions would have been expected to have seen far fewer deaths, or 15,910, based on statistical modeling using data from previous years, it said.
